Dead stock 1986/7 Yamaha SDR200.
Two-stroke, water cooled single cyl., Trellis cradle, 6 spd., Reed valve, 230 lb., 40 hp, 0 - 60 4.9 sec.

I bought the first two (73.5 & 74’s) from a co-worker who put them in a storage locker 26 years ago. I am currently restoring them to look like new. The third one, also ‘74, was on the MRC - Morini Riders Club website. It was a show bike in 2014 but got put in a shed and now needs some cosmetic love. Most of the MRC guys are overseas but this bike was in CT. Just a couple hours away.

I like the cafe racer style. The fact that these bikes did more with less - lightweight and great handling but not much power, is really similar to the 914 story and I have a couple of those.

I also think the double drum model of this bike is and will be the most desirable year of the Sport, like a 911 RS. At least in my mind.
